Delrin® 527UVE RD402 is a red, UV-stabilized, medium viscosity acetal homopolymer with very low VOC emissions, developed for automotive interior applications. Processing methods include injection molding.
Polymer Name: Polyacetal Homopolymer (POM)
Processing Methods: Injection Molding
Additives Included: Mold Release Agent
Flexural Modulus: 3100.0 MPa

Mechanical Properties
Value | Units | Test Method / Conditions | |
Tensile Modulus | 3200 | MPa | ISO 527 |
Hardness, Rockwell | 121 | Scale R | ISO 2039-2 |
Hardness, Rockwell | 92.4 | Scale M | ISO 2039-2 |
Yield Stress | 73 | MPa | ISO 527-1/-2 |
Yield Strain | 15 | % | ISO 527-1/-2 |
Nominal Strain at Break | 30 | % | ISO 527-1/-2 |
Flexural Modulus | 3100 | MPa | ASTM D790 |
Flexural Stress at 3.5% | 85 | MPa | ISO 178 |
Charpy Impact Strength (23°C) | 270 | kJ/m² | ISO 179/1eU |
Charpy Impact Strength (-30°C) | 250 | kJ/m2 | ISO 179/1eU |
Charpy Notched Impact Strength (23°C) | 7 | kJ/m2 | ISO 179-1/1eA |
Poisson's Ratio | 0.37 | - | ASTM D638 |
Physical Properties
Value | Units | Test Method / Conditions | |
Melt Volume - Flow Rate | 13 | cm³/10min | ISO 1133 |
Load | 2.16 | kg | ISO 1133 |
Molding Shrinkage - Parallel | 2.0 | % | ISO 294-4, 2577 |
Molding Shrinkage - Normal | 1.9 | % | ISO 294-4, 2577 |
Temperature | 190 | °C | ISO 1133 |
Thermal Properties
Value | Units | Test Method / Conditions | |
Melting Temperature (10°C/min) | 178 | °C | ISO 11357-1/-3 |
Temperature of Deflection Under Load(1.8 MPa) | 94 | °C | ISO 75-1/-2 |
Temperature of Deflection Under Load (0.45 MPa) | 160 | °C | ISO 75-1/-2 |
Vicat Softening Temperature (50°C/h, 10N) | 174 | °C | ISO 306 |
Coefficient of Linear Thermal Expansion - Parallel | 110 | E-6/K | ISO 11359-1/-2 |
Coefficient of Linear Thermal Expansion - Normal | 110 | E-6/K | ISO 11359-1/-2 |
Flammability
Value | Units | Test Method / Conditions | |
FMVSS Class | B | - | ISO 3795 (FMVSS 302) |
Burning Rate (1 mm, Thickness) | max. 80 | mm/min | ISO 3795 (FMVSS 302) |
Other Properties
Value | Units | Test Method / Conditions | |
Humidity Absorption (2 mm) | 0.2 | % | Sim. to ISO 62 |
Water Absorption (2 mm) | 1.2 | % | Sim. to ISO 62 |
Density | 1420 | kg/m³ | ISO 1183 |
Density of Melt | 1160 | kg/m³ | - |
Processing Information (Injection Molding)
Value | Units | Test Method / Conditions | |
Drying Recommended | Yes | - | - |
Drying Temperature | 80 | °C | - |
Drying Time (Dehumidified Dryer) | 2.0 - 4.0 | h | - |
Processing Moisture Content | ≤0.2 | % | - |
Melt Temperature Optimum | 205 | °C | - |
Min. Melt Temperature | 200 | °C | - |
Max. Melt Temperature | 210 | °C | - |
Mold Temperature Optimum | 90 | °C | - |
Min. Mold Temperature | 80 | °C | - |
Max. Mold Temperature | 100 | °C | - |
Hold Pressure Range | 80 - 100 | MPa | - |
Hold Pressure Time | 8 | s/mm | - |
Annealing Time - Optional | 30 | min/mm | - |
Annealing Temperature | 160 | °C | - |
VDA Properties
Value | Units | Test Method / Conditions | |
Light Stability - Delta E | 1 | - | DIN 53236 |
Light Stability Grey Scale | 4 | - | ISO 105-A02 |
Emissions | max. 2 | mg/100g/kg/100g | VDA 275 |
Chemical Resistance
Chemical Type | Chemical Name | Resistance |
Acids | Acetic Acid (5% by mass) (23°C) | Probably Resistant |
Acids | Chromic Acid solution (40% by mass) (23°C) | Not Recommended |
Acids | Citric Acid solution (10% by mass) (23°C) | Not Recommended |
Acids | Hydrochloric Acid (36% by mass) (23°C) | Not Recommended |
Acids | Lactic Acid (10% by mass) (23°C) | Not Recommended |
Acids | Nitric Acid (40% by mass) (23°C) | Not Recommended |
Acids | Sulfuric Acid (38% by mass) (23°C) | Not Recommended |
Acids | Sulfuric Acid (5% by mass) (23°C) | Not Recommended |
Alcohols | Ethanol (23°C) | Probably Resistant |
Alcohols | Isopropyl alcohol (23°C) | Probably Resistant |
Alcohols | Methanol (23°C) | Probably Resistant |
Bases | Ammonium Hydroxide solution (10% by mass) (23°C) | Not Recommended |
Bases | Sodium Hydroxide solution (1% by mass) (23°C) | Not Recommended |
Bases | Sodium Hydroxide solution (35% by mass) (23°C) | Not Recommended |
Ethers | Diethyl ether (23°C) | Probably Resistant |
Hydrocarbons | iso-Octane (23°C) | Probably Resistant |
Hydrocarbons | n-Hexane (23°C) | Probably Resistant |
Hydrocarbons | Toluene (23°C) | Probably Resistant |
Ketones | Acetone (23°C) | Probably Resistant |
Mineral oils | Automatic hypoid-gear oil Shell Donax TX (135°C) | Not Recommended |
Mineral oils | Hydraulic oil Pentosin CHF 202 (125°C) | Not Recommended |
Mineral oils | Insulating Oil (23°C) | Probably Resistant |
Mineral oils | Motor oil OS206 304 Ref.Eng.Oil, ISP (135°C) | Not Recommended |
Mineral oils | SAE 10W40 multigrade motor oil (130°C) | Not Recommended |
Mineral oils | SAE 10W40 multigrade motor oil (23°C) | Probably Resistant |
Mineral oils | SAE 80/90 hypoid-gear oil (130°C) | Not Recommended |
Other | 1% nonylphenoxy-polyethyleneoxy ethanol in water (23°C) | Probably Resistant |
Other | 50% Oleic acid + 50% Olive Oil (23°C) | Probably Resistant |
Other | Coolant Glysantin G48, 1:1 in water (125°C) | Not Recommended |
Other | DOT No. 4 Brake fluid (120°C) | Not Recommended |
Other | DOT No. 4 Brake fluid (130°C) | Not Recommended |
Other | Ethyl Acetate (23°C) | Probably Resistant |
Other | Ethylene Glycol (50% by mass) in water (108°C) | Not Recommended |
Other | Hydrogen peroxide (23°C) | Not Recommended |
Other | Phenol solution (5% by mass) (23°C) | Not Recommended |
Other | Water (23°C) | Probably Resistant |
Other | Water (90°C) | Not Recommended |
Salt solutions | Sodium Carbonate solution (2% by mass) (23°C) | Not Recommended |
Salt solutions | Sodium Carbonate solution (20% by mass) (23°C) | Not Recommended |
Salt solutions | Sodium Chloride solution (10% by mass) (23°C) | Probably Resistant |
Salt solutions | Sodium Hypochlorite solution (10% by mass) (23°C) | Not Recommended |
Salt solutions | Zinc Chloride solution (50% by mass) (23°C) | Not Recommended |
Standard Fuels | Diesel EN 590 (100°C) | Probably Resistant |
Standard Fuels | Diesel fuel (pref. ISO 1817 Liquid F) (>90°C) | Not Recommended |
Standard Fuels | Diesel fuel (pref. ISO 1817 Liquid F) (23°C) | Probably Resistant |
Standard Fuels | Diesel fuel (pref. ISO 1817 Liquid F) (90°C) | Not Recommended |
Standard Fuels | ISO 1817 Liquid 1 - E5 (60°C) | Probably Resistant |
Standard Fuels | ISO 1817 Liquid 2 - M15E4 (60°C) | Probably Resistant |
Standard Fuels | ISO 1817 Liquid 3 - M3E7 (60°C) | Probably Resistant |
Standard Fuels | ISO 1817 Liquid 4 - M15 (60°C) | Probably Resistant |
Standard Fuels | Standard fuel with alcohol (pref. ISO 1817 Liquid 4) (23°C) | Probably Resistant |
Standard Fuels | Standard fuel without alcohol (pref. ISO 1817 Liquid C) (23°C) | Probably Resistant |
